Endometrial cancer is more common in women over 50 years old, especially postmenopausal women, which may be related to the long-term hormone stimulation of the endometrium and the lack of progesterone to counteract it. Unmarried, less children, delayed menopause, obesity, diabetes, hypertension, and other cardiovascular diseases are high-risk factors for endometrial cancer.

Since the cause of endometrial cancer is still unclear, the focus should be on early detection and early treatment. For postmenopausal bleeding and menopausal menstrual disorders, the possibility of endometrial cancer should be excluded. For young women whose menstrual disorders are not effectively treated, B-ultrasound examination and endometrial examination should be performed in time. Pay attention to the precancerous lesions of endometrial cancer. For those who have been confirmed to have precancerous lesions such as atypical endometrial hyperplasia, total hysterectomy should be performed according to the patient's condition. Those who want to have children should be given high-dose progesterone treatment in time and monitor the changes in their condition.

Change your lifestyle, eat in moderation, and exercise more, and reduce the incidence of endometrial cancer by controlling high blood pressure, diabetes, obesity and other "rich diseases". As for vaccines, there is no vaccine developed yet.
